patch 8.2.3072: "zy" does not work well when "virtualedit' is "block"

Problem:    The "zy" command does not work well when 'virtualedit' is set to
            "block". (Johann Höchtl)
Solution:   Make endspaces zero. (Christian Brabandt, closes #8468,
            closes #8448)
diff --git a/src/register.c b/src/register.c
index 4774e2a..93ee7aa 100644
--- a/src/register.c
+++ b/src/register.c
@@ -1455,6 +1455,8 @@
 {
     char_u	*pnew;
 
+    if (exclude_trailing_space)
+	bd->endspaces = 0;
     if ((pnew = alloc(bd->startspaces + bd->endspaces + bd->textlen + 1))
 								      == NULL)
 	return FAIL;
@@ -2747,7 +2749,7 @@
 		&yank_type) == FAIL)
 	return;
 
-    str_to_reg(y_current, yank_type, (char_u *) strings, -1, block_len, TRUE);
+    str_to_reg(y_current, yank_type, (char_u *)strings, -1, block_len, TRUE);
 
     finish_write_reg(name, old_y_previous, old_y_current);
 }

+func Test_visual_put_blockedit_zy_and_zp()
+  new
+
+  call setline(1, ['aa', 'bbbbb', 'ccc', '', 'XX', 'GGHHJ', 'RTZU'])
+  exe "normal! gg0\<c-v>2j$zy"
+  norm! 5gg0zP
+  call assert_equal(['aa', 'bbbbb', 'ccc', '', 'aaXX', 'bbbbbGGHHJ', 'cccRTZU'], getline(1, 7))
+  "
+  " now with blockmode editing
+  sil %d
+  :set ve=block
+  call setline(1, ['aa', 'bbbbb', 'ccc', '', 'XX', 'GGHHJ', 'RTZU'])
+  exe "normal! gg0\<c-v>2j$zy"
+  norm! 5gg0zP
+  call assert_equal(['aa', 'bbbbb', 'ccc', '', 'aaXX', 'bbbbbGGHHJ', 'cccRTZU'], getline(1, 7))
+  set ve&vim
+  bw!
+endfunc
